X. PAS Evaluation

To determine the PAS Pilot’s effectiveness, a review team composed of recipient and FEMA representatives will conduct an evaluation. For recipients that participate, an evaluation will be conducted six years after the program starts. This evaluation will be different from the monitoring and auditing activities and will focus on the program rather than recipient performance. This team will evaluate the level of success of the PAS Pilot based on the previously identified program evaluation criteria, identify PAS Pilot components that worked well and make recommendations for any needed improvements or changes.

Performance metrics used to evaluate the PAS Pilot include measuring if recipient-administered programs are more efficient than traditionally run programs. Specifically, metrics will be used to evaluate if the program increased or decreased costs to administer HMGP and HMGP Post Fire, expedited or delayed obligations and project completions, and contributed to the overall effectiveness of the program.
